2011-11-08 35 views
1

我正在編寫一個項目,我必須編寫一個創建兩個整型變量(一個稱爲Var1和一個稱爲Var2)的簡單腳本,分別將值2和4放入它們中,然後輸出兩個變量的值 加在一起。由於我仍然在學習編寫腳本和批處理,所以對我來說有點困惑。這是我到目前爲止有:具有兩個變量的腳本

Declare @total 
@Var1 var1 [= 2][, 
@Var2 var2 [= 4]]] 
Set @total = @Var1 + @Var2 

說實話還挺看起來funny.I我只是不明白這樣做,或者如果我這樣做是正確的。在某種程度上,我不認爲我應該甚至把它放在那裏,但不知道如何在最後加上兩個變量。我知道一個聲明腳本是你可以一次聲明一個或多個變量。所以這就是爲什麼我爲這個聲明做了聲明。

+0

什麼樣的SQL的這是什麼? MS SQL Server? –

+0

是的,它是微軟的SQL服務器2008 – norris1023

回答

3
Declare @total int 
declare @Var1 int =2 --in sql 2008 
declare @Var2 int =4 --in sql 2008 
Set @total = @Var1 + @Var2 

Declare @total int 
declare @Var1 
    set @var1=2 
declare @Var2 
    set @var2=4 
Set @total = @Var1 + @Var2 
+0

好吧,所以我沒有那麼遠謝謝Royi – norris1023

4

嘗試:

DECLARE @a int 
SET @a=2 
DECLARE @b int 
SET @b=2 
DECLARE @Result int 
SET @[email protected] + @b 

print @Result 
相關問題